Understand cystitis and urinary tract infections
Cystitis is inflammation of the bladder that can be caused by bacteria, viruses or chemical irritations.
It is a common condition that can cause burning when urinating, frequent need to urinate, and pain in the pelvic area.
UTIs are often treated with antibiotics, but this approach can have limitations.
Some bacterial strains can become resistant to antibiotics, making treatment less effective.
Additionally, prolonged use of antibiotics can damage the gut microbiota, compromising the immune system and making the body more susceptible to future infections.

Herbal remedies for cystitis
Cranberry and its role in the prevention and treatment of urinary tract infections
Cranberries have long been considered a traditional remedy for urinary tract infections.
This fruit contains a compound called proanthocyanidin, which prevents bacteria from adhering to the walls of the bladder, thus reducing the risk of infection.
Additionally, cranberries have anti-inflammatory properties that can help reduce bladder inflammation.
Cranberry can be consumed in juice, supplement or herbal tea form to reap its benefits.
However, it's important to note that cranberry juice can be high in added sugar, so it's best to opt for sugar-free options.

Bearberry and its antimicrobial effects
Bearberry is an herb traditionally used to treat urinary tract infections.
It contains a compound called arbutin, which is converted to hydroquinone in the urinary tract.
Hydroquinone has antimicrobial properties, which can help fight the bacteria responsible for urinary infections.
It can be consumed in herbal tea or supplement form to obtain its antimicrobial benefits.
However, it is important to note that it should not be used for long periods of time, as it can cause urinary tract irritation.
Marshmallow root and its soothing properties
Marshmallow root is a plant that contains mucilages, which are gelatinous substances that can coat and soothe inflamed urinary tracts.
This herb has anti-inflammatory properties that can help reduce the pain and inflammation caused by cystitis.
Marshmallow root can be consumed in herbal tea or supplement form to obtain its soothing benefits.
However, it's important to note that marshmallow root can reduce the absorption of other medications, so it's best to take it at least two hours apart from other medications.

Other lifestyle changes to manage and prevent cystitis
In addition to using herbal solutions, there are other lifestyle changes that can help manage and prevent cystitis.
Some of these changes include:
- Drink plenty of water to promote urine production and clean the urinary tract.
- Urinate regularly to avoid urinary retention and bacterial growth.
- Maintain good personal hygiene, avoiding aggressive detergents and tight clothing.
- Avoid the excessive use of antibiotics, which can damage the intestinal microbiota.
- Support the immune system through a healthy and balanced diet, regular exercise and stress management.
